      Matthew Ashby is an Astrophysicist at the Harvard- Smithsonian Center for Astrophysics. He became a member of the SWAS mission team in 1995, and has also been a member of the IRAC instrument team since 1999. His research interests involve working to better understand the sources of infrared emission from galaxies, and modelling the radiative transfer processes taking place in Galactic star formation complexes. This work is based on data now being taken by the Spitzer Space Telescope and other observatories, both ground- and space-based.

      Dr. Ashby is leading an effort to characterize star formation in the local universe (the Star Formation Reference Survey). He is also involved in a number of Spitzer/IRAC Guaranteed Time and Guest Observer science projects with a special focus on infrared observations of galaxies in the nearby and distant Universe.
